NSÍ Runavík
Description
NSÍ Runavík is a Faroese football club, playing in Runavík founded in 1957. In 2003 NSÍ participated for the first time on a European stage.
In 2007 the club won the Faroe Islands Premier League for the first time.
The club has won the Faroe Islands Cup in 1986 and 2002. Aside from these instances, NSÍ Runavík featured in the 1980, 1985, 1988 and 2004 tournament finals.
The club plays in black and yellow. Their stadium, Runavík Stadium, has a capacity of 4000.
